STUDENT PLUS ACCOUNT

For members age 18 years and older who are enrolled in a full-time diploma or degree program at a recognized Canadian postsecondary institution. This account helps young adults control their money and work toward financial independence. We are taking care of our own by offering:

  • A $25 signing bonus when you open a Student Plus account
  • Free Point of Sale (POS) transactions from a chequing account
  • Free ATM deposits and withdrawals through THE EXCHANGE® Network and Police Credit Union machines
  • Free Smartphone apps to find the nearest EXCHANGE ATM from over 2,400 across Canada
  • Free online banking for all of your financial requirements, including bill payments 
  • Free paperless statements are eco-friendly
  • Free mobile banking means 24-hour access to your balances anytime, anywhere
  • Free incoming email money transfers through Interac e-Transfer are the fastest way to receive money on time
  • Earn more money on a savings account - interest is calculated daily at the higher REWARDS rate
  • No-fee Student MasterCard* available
  • Free “round it up” savings with every POS transaction (optional) - helps you save money every time you use your Member Card

And there are NO monthly package fees and NO minimum monthly balance requirements.

STUDENT LINE OF CREDIT
When heading off to college or university, your focus should be on your studies, not your finances. Turn to your Credit Union first when seeking a student loan. With competitive rates and easy repayment plans, it's sure to make the grade.

Eligibility:
Student must be a Canadian citizen, 18 years of age or older, and enrolled in a full-time degree or diploma program at a recognized postsecondary institution in Canada. Loan approval* requires a qualified borrower (co-signer) such as parents or guardian.

Student To Provide:

  • An estimate of education costs such as tuition and accommodation
  • A list of financial resources available to handle those expenses
  • Confirmation of enrollment in a recognized Canadian postsecondary institution

Line of Credit Details:

  • Loan amounts range from $5,000 to $10,000 per year with a lifetime maximum of $40,000
  • Funds can be accessed by ATM, Interac e-Transfer money transfer, or cheques on account

Repayment:

  • While you're enrolled as a full-time student, interest-only payments are required each month
  • Repayment will begin one year after graduation or course completion
  • The line of credit is not accessible after graduation or course completion
  • If a longer amortization period is required, the line of credit can be converted to a fixed rate loan one year after graduation or course completion
  • The co-signer(s) remains on the loan or line of credit until it is fully repaid
  • All or part of the loan may be paid at any time without penalty
